In order to meet future utility scale $/kWh targets, PV electric power installations must continue to increase reliability and reduce operating cost. Life targets for DC-AC inverters are 15-20 years, but a Sandia-DOE study showed that inverter cooling fans were failing on an average of 2.2 years from first installation. When the fan fails the inverter shuts down and fan replacement impacts both operating cost and reliability.
C-Fans can be designed for 15 years L10 or 20 Years L10 if required. Other renewable energy technologies such as concentrated solar power, hydrogen fuel cells, energy storage and wind turbines depend on outdoor power electronics like inverters and power converters, and all can benefit from the increased reliability and reduced operating cost of C-Fans.
